As the HubSpot Solutions Architect your role is to architect solutions with the HubSpot CRM in the front and center, and may include data migrations and systems integrations, taking into account clients existing technology and business processes. For candidates joining Huble into this role, experience in CRM systems is beneficial, it is not a requirement. What matters most is your ability to design effective architectures, develop data strategies, leverage APIs, and create seamless system integrations that address complex business challenges.
🚀 Key Performance Areas:
1) Understand Client Requirements | Client Satisfaction | Solution Architecture
- Drive technology success and process transformation in client companies.
- Host Discovery Sessions following a proven methodology and consult with clients to understand client needs and processes through research and workshops with the client.
- Define, strategise and implement data models and data flows to and from the HubSpot CRM to meet customers processes and automation needs.
- Ensure the right solutions are being proposed for the client’s needs, goals, business requirements and processes across the sales, marketing and service tech stack.
- Be able to communicate clearly your proposed solution internally to Developers.
- Communicate the benefits of your recommendations to clients.
- Produce requirements documentation, ERD documents, business processes (“as is” and “to be”), functional specifications, data transformation documents.
- Run workshops and training sessions.
- Produce off-boarding documentation.
- Perform UAT to ensure the brief has been correctly executed.
